Not too familiar with your bike, but you shouldn't have to split the cases. The water pump should be housed in the crank case COVER. If you drain the coolant and remove this cover you can remove the shaft and replace the seals (water and oil seals) quite easily if needed, and the seals are cheap.
You should also check the bearing too - you will have to remove it anyway.

I did the whole water pump on a cr250 a while back. The only costly part was the shaft itself. The bearing and seals were cheap.
